Before getting into the practical technical aspect of the digital workflow of this facial scanner, I want to clarify the importance of 3D acquisition of the patient's face. Presenting yourself at the dental office, with which we collaborate, with a facial scanner allows us to digitize the face of our patient through very simple steps, which will be imported into a design software, to be coupled to the previously acquired models. The fundamental reason for this very simple step is to know exactly the inclination of the upper jaw in the digital space, which, at times, could create orientation problems, if we did not have photos or facial scans.


Personally, combined with the facial scan, I always recommend doctors to take photographs of the patient, since they too can be imported into the design software and coupled with face scan. In this way we will work with overlapping 2D photos and 3D scanning, where with 2D we will use the DSD protocols with the golden proportions, while in 3D we will orient ourselves in the digital space respecting the aesthetic criteria (the bipupillary line, the median, the line commisural and the labial corridor) for functionality we will have regard to the over jet and the over bite (for lip support) and the curves of Spee and Wilson (for the correct assembly of our digital teeth). At this point we have all the necessary information to start our rehabilitation. DOF Face Scan
PRACTICAL TECHNICAL ASPECTS
The DOF facial scan system uses an automatic repositioning principle, using points recognized by the software. As you can see in the image on the side, the identification plate is hooked to a fork, which acts as a support to take the patient's bite. Once the digital image of the bite has been created, it will be coupled to the previously acquired master model. This very simple step is the fundamental point of our treatment plan. The importance and precision of these acquisitions are indispensable for accurately determining the inclination of the upper jaw, providing the technician with the correct parameters for the development of rehabilitation. In this phase it is possible to acquire the patient's facial scan, and align our scans. In the case of a total rehabilitation on implants, it is possible to import the X-ray and align it to the sagittal plane of the facial scan, we may also be able to import DICOM files, to view the volumetric rendering of the facial bones.



Face Scanner SNAP
The acquisition time is extremely short, just move the tablet horizontally from right to left, and the software will make the necessary acquisitions by itself. In my opinion I prefer that the scanning station is fixed, with a set of suitable lights, placed on the sides of the device. Allowing the patient to rotate on its axis without tilting the head. I have found excellent results with this acquisition protocol. Of fundamental importance is the formation of the dental practice, with this digital flow, in most of the studies with which I collaborate, the dental assistants acquire the patient's information, then sending it to the laboratory via email or online portals. Passed the step of the dental office and collected all the information, there is the control of the acquisitions in the design software, here we will find our models coupled to the facial scan, our radiography with perfectly aligned models. The peculiarity of working with this system is that of interacting on a single "Z" axis, which allows us to import all the acquisitions made in the various previous steps and always find them aligned on each other, whenever you want to open the project.
